(Reuters) - Emerson Electric Co is selling a majority stake in its climate-technologies business to Blackstone Inc in a deal that would value the unit at $14 billion including debt, the Wall Street Journal reported on Monday.
The deal, expected to be announced on Monday, would give Blackstone a 55% stake in the unit, the newspaper said citing executives.
